Warning Signs You Need Rental Property Water Damage Restoration
Catching water damage early is crucial to preventing costly repairs and lost rental income. Here are some warning signs you need to look out for: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, persistent odors can be a sign of mold growth, which can lead to serious health issues and costly repairs. If you notice a musty smell in your rental property, it’s essential to investigate and address the issue quickly.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age, which can lead to costly repairs and even safety hazards. If you notice your flooring is warped or buckled, don’t delay, contact us today to schedule a restoration.
Water Stains or Discoloration
Water stains or discoloration on walls or ceilings can be a sign of water damage, which can lead to costly repairs and even safety hazards. If you notice water stains or discoloration, it’s essential to investigate and address the issue quickly.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age, which can lead to costly repairs and even safety hazards. If you notice peeling paint or wallpaper, don’t delay, contact us today to schedule a restoration.
Unusual Noises or Sounds
Unusual noises or sounds, such as creaking or groaning, can be a sign of water damage, which can lead to costly repairs and even safety hazards. If you notice unusual noises or sounds, it’s essential to investigate and address the issue quickly.

Rental Property Water Damage Restoration Cost In Lake Stevens, WA
The cost of rental property water damage restoration in Lake Stevens, WA, varies based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our estimates are based on a thorough assessment of your property, and we’ll work with you to ensure you receive the best possible value for your investment.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ction and Drying | $500 – $2,500 | The size of the affected area and the amount of water involved. |
| Cleaning and Sanitizing | $200 – $1,000 | The extent of the damage and the type of surfaces affected. |
| Repair and Replacement | $1,000 – $5,000 | The extent of the damage and the materials needed for repair or replacement. |
| Mold Remediation | $500 – $2,000 | The extent of the mold growth and the materials needed for remediation. |
| Final Inspection and Certificate of Completion | $100 – $500 | The complexity of the job and the number of inspections required. |
